azimuth-stabilized plan position indicator

[′az·ə·məth ¦sta·bə‚līzd ′plan pə′zish·ən ′in·də‚kād·ər] (engineering) A north-upward plan position indicator (PPI), a radarscope, which is stabilized by a gyrocompass so that either true or magnetic north is always at the top of the scope regardless of vehicle orientation.
